Drive the future of collaborative open source development tooling as part of the Launchpad team. This is an opportunity for a motivated engineering manager with a passion for open source software, Linux, and web services to join our distributed team.

Launchpad is a robust platform for managing open source development projects. It includes code hosting and review, bug tracking, package building, translations, and other facilities used by free and open source software developers. It provides essential development infrastructure for major projects such as Ubuntu.
